"T APPEAL to the Government to

1 review the allocation of commercial vehicles to the home market," said Sir George Kenning, LP., chairman of Kennings, Ltd., at the company's annual meeting, on Monday.

"The retention of an increasingly large proportion of old vehicles is," he said, "not in the best interests of this country's transport economy or road safety, and there is a good case for the revision of the allocation of steel to assist commercial-vehicle production. The Nation's transport should not be sacrificed on the altar of export figure.s and statistics."
